Snickers ProtecWork 2562: Anti-Static Flame-Resistant Hi-Vis T-Shirt, Class 3
The Snickers 2562 ProtecWork Hi-Vis T-Shirt is a protective base layer built for professionals in high-risk environments. It combines anti-static, flame-retardant properties with Class 3 visibility and a soft, comfortable hand feel for all-day wear.
- Class 3 High-Visibility: High-visibility t-shirt with heat-transfer reflective tape to ensure you stay seen in varied lighting and work conditions.
- Anti-Static & Flame-Resistant: Engineered to reduce static buildup while providing basic protection against heat and flame as part of a layered ProtecWork system.
- Layering Flexibility: Designed as a reliable first layer that can be combined with ProtecWork mid- and outer-layer garments to achieve enhanced protection.
- Arc-Exposure Limitation: Short-sleeve design is not arc-rated; for electric-arc environments, use the long-sleeve version 2461 built from the same protective fabric.
- Material & Comfort: 60%Modacrylic, 37% Cotton, 3% Belltron, 230 g/m² for a soft, smooth touch and durable performance.
- Protective Standards Details: ATPV 6.4 cal/cm², class 1 (4 kA) and HAF 69.6% indicate measurable protection levels when used with appropriate protective layers.
